)]}'
{
  "commit": "abda07cf4969632987fa795bcce3422ba67c2d13",
  "tree": "a17b63eb679e0f462a31c367d893f368d3b0bc12",
  "parents": [
    "cdf8510355e30e8145ec708bc767080423d0c77e"
  ],
  "author": {
    "name": "Sidath Senanayake",
    "email": "sidaths@google.com",
    "time": "Thu Jun 06 22:24:15 2019 +0100"
  },
  "committer": {
    "name": "Sidath Senanayake",
    "email": "sidaths@google.com",
    "time": "Wed Jun 26 09:43:56 2019 +0000"
  },
  "message": "Process GPU frequency info from ftrace if available\n\nIf a GPU driver outputs frequency information via ftrace on the\npower/gpu_frequency event using the same format at used for CPU\nfrequency, process it as a counter named gpufreq.\n\nNote that these only include the device side changes from the\ncommit this was cherry-picked from.\n\n(cherry picked from commit 1f5f93a931104d7daed5b952653fc2244d2e299e)\n\nBug: 136062452\nMerged-In: I93644c0cdd8835668f2f3807b53c7bc429ec9d77\nChange-Id: I00cc9230d5c11777a7926ec24486ec3a0e5bb839\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"5e27dac4fb05246fa85fdabe24c423b576488a86",
      "old_mode": 33188,
      "old_path": "protos/perfetto/trace/ftrace/ftrace_event.proto",
      "new_id": "6996d0afbdbfd904677c6027aa14d4d45d6a1e02",
      "new_mode": 33188,
      "new_path": "protos/perfetto/trace/ftrace/ftrace_event.proto"
    },
    {
      "type": "modify",
      "old_id": "b8548e5f1fe38b99ed9ff566c1cb48b205a6fc5e",
      "old_mode": 33188,
      "old_path": "protos/perfetto/trace/ftrace/power.proto",
      "new_id": "a79cc03f31c52a5850e3297dbfa5ad908676dbda",
      "new_mode": 33188,
      "new_path": "protos/perfetto/trace/ftrace/power.proto"
    },
    {
      "type": "modify",
      "old_id": "0d1c759f71a7289ab8dc7339214d225a25bc9e9b",
      "old_mode": 33188,
      "old_path": "protos/perfetto/trace/perfetto_trace.proto",
      "new_id": "f563be5ff7bcc7d35806f894b84c80aaf266796b",
      "new_mode": 33188,
      "new_path": "protos/perfetto/trace/perfetto_trace.proto"
    },
    {
      "type": "modify",
      "old_id": "a54d23513d45a3e08ade2668c44019031df99f80",
      "old_mode": 33188,
      "old_path": "src/perfetto_cmd/perfetto_cmd.cc",
      "new_id": "e1f71dd1d6ff0e88f1d10a5668930c7b33e0634f",
      "new_mode": 33188,
      "new_path": "src/perfetto_cmd/perfetto_cmd.cc"
    },
    {
      "type": "modify",
      "old_id": "92ed091c6eae825f374d3cc50185bc8d543cff48",
      "old_mode": 33188,
      "old_path": "src/traced/probes/ftrace/event_info.cc",
      "new_id": "657a459b36eb0e959668b44b38d72fd5c194eb95",
      "new_mode": 33188,
      "new_path": "src/traced/probes/ftrace/event_info.cc"
    },
    {
      "type": "modify",
      "old_id": "a8d44d3fc7e6e5657777573285f6dff14bee3111",
      "old_mode": 33188,
      "old_path": "src/traced/probes/ftrace/ftrace_config_muxer.cc",
      "new_id": "4dbf313b8723d3e5aee97e94ba03611ffecd26a6",
      "new_mode": 33188,
      "new_path": "src/traced/probes/ftrace/ftrace_config_muxer.cc"
    },
    {
      "type": "add",
      "old_id": "0000000000000000000000000000000000000000",
      "old_mode": 0,
      "old_path": "/dev/null",
      "new_id": "6b770711363502caba4ad94a74870d7cce6e74dc",
      "new_mode": 33188,
      "new_path": "src/traced/probes/ftrace/test/data/synthetic/events/power/gpu_frequency/format"
    },
    {
      "type": "modify",
      "old_id": "9f9737acf46bfaac56ec4496d30b10a6ae32930c",
      "old_mode": 33188,
      "old_path": "tools/ftrace_proto_gen/event_whitelist",
      "new_id": "e0662ce327feb93377c6bf335e4dea3edb600a10",
      "new_mode": 33188,
      "new_path": "tools/ftrace_proto_gen/event_whitelist"
    }
  ]
}
